Most of us resist setbacks and struggles, but both are crucial to our growth. In fact, the most successful investors respond to failure with resilience. These investors pick themselves up, dust themselves off, and then take the next step of uncomfortable action toward their dreams of financial freedom.

Rob Rowsell embodies that kind of human will. In 1999, he was a homeless crack addict living on the streets. Then, he stumbled into a rehab center, and through sheer grit, Rob turned his life around. Today, he is a real estate investor and motivational speaker, as well as multiple business owner and bestselling author of Addicted to Life.

On this episode of Financial Freedom with Real Estate Investing, Rob joins cohost Garrett Lynch and me to share his journey from homeless addict to successful multifamily investor. He explains why so many aspiring investors don’t succeed, challenging us to develop a strong WHY and leverage visualization to reach our goals. Listen in for Rob’s insight on cultivating the mindset where you need to take action, grow through the challenges, and achieve financial freedom as a multifamily investor!

Key Takeaways

Rob’s struggle with addiction

  • Hooked on both meth and crack cocaine
  • Homeless and unemployable

What inspired Rob’s decision to change

  • Realized he was now on the path to death or prison
  • Pain to stay the same was greater than the pain to change

How Rob got back into society

  • Choose new people, places, and things
  • Willing to take uncomfortable action

Why aspiring investors don’t take action

  • Biggest hurdle is equal to previous successes
  • They lack a big enough WHY

How Rob uses visualization to reach his goals

  • Write out your goals as if they are already accomplished
  • Read over in order to instill yearning and belief

The traits of a successful entrepreneur

  • Builds momentum via stacked action
  • Willing to act despite uncertainty
  • Grow through catastrophic failure

How Rob used knowledge in order to build momentum

Rob’s intro to real estate

  • Bought auto repair shops with no money down
  • Used hard money for first few SFHs

How Rob grew a 1K-unit multifamily portfolio, leading to financial freedom

  • Start with SFH buy-and-hold strategy
  • Flip SFHs into small multifamily
  • Reinvest profits in larger multifamily

Have you ever experienced hardships you thought you would never overcome? Today’s guest is best selling author of the book, “Addicted to Life – Your 8-Step Formula for Achievement,” Rob Rowsell. Rob’s story is one of both hardship and triumph, as well as  inspiration. Learn about prosperity through multifamily real estate investing from someone who has lived it!

Rob struggled with a life of drug addiction, which led him to homelessness. After meeting his future wife, he decided he was “done.” Rob began his extraordinary journey of recovery and entrepreneurial success. This journey has landed him in the Hall of Fame for two different prominent real estate mentorship programs. He is also now a best selling author.

Rob shares his 8 step formula for achievement with us that can apply to any aspect of our lives:

  1. You have got to be done.
  2. Get uncomfortable and then take action.
  3. You must create the wave of momentum.
  4. Prepare now for what’s coming.
  5. You must be open to the unexpected.
  6. You won’t always feel like your winning.
  7. Understand the law of exposure.
  8. You won’t do it alone.

Rob is a huge advocate of coaches in every aspect of his life in order to continue to build success. Set 1, 3, and 5 year goals and then develop quarterly action plans to pave your path of success. Coaches will not only guide you but also help to hold you accountable. You should always invest in yourself.
